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ft assumed coverage on shares of Garrett Motion (NYSE:GTX – Free Report) in a report released on Monday, Marketbeat Ratings reports. The brokerage issued a hold rating and a $14.00 price target on the stock.
A number of other research analysts have also recently commented on the company. BNP Paribas Exane assumed coverage on Garrett Motion in a research note on Wednesday, July 16th. They issued an “outperform” rating and a $14.00 target price for the company. Zacks Research upgraded Garrett Motion from a “hold” rating to a “strong-buy” rating in a research note on Wednesday, October 1st. Stifel Nicolaus assumed coverage on Garrett Motion in a research note on Friday, September 19th. They issued a “buy” rating and a $17.50 target price for the company. BNP Paribas assumed coverage on Garrett Motion in a research note on Wednesday, July 16th. They issued an “outperform” rating for the company. Finally, BWS Financial raised their target price on Garrett Motion from $14.00 to $18.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research note on Tuesday, September 30th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, four have assigned a Buy rating and one has assigned a Hold r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at, Garrett Motion presently has a consensus r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of $15.75.

Insiders Place Their Bets
In other Garrett Motion news, insider Centerbridge Credit Partners M sold 9,000,000 shares of Garrett Motion stock in a transaction on Wednesday, August 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of $12.27, for a total transaction of $110,430,000.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the insider owned 4,740,569 shares in the company, valued at approximately $58,166,781.63. The trade was a 65.50%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. Also, major shareholder Cyrus Capital Partners, L.P. sold 1,300,000 shares of Garrett Motion stock in a transaction on Tuesday, August 19th. The shares were sold at an average price of $13.00, for a total value of $16,900,000.00. Following the transaction, the insider owned 21,128,348 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$274,668,524. The trade was a 5.80%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old 11,685,545 shares of company stock valued at $145,663,491 in the last quarter. 0.60% of the stock is owned by company insiders.

Garrett Motion Company Profile
Garrett Motion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, and sells turbocharging, air and fluid compression, and high-speed electric motor technologies for original equipment manufacturers and distributors worldwide. The company offers cutting-edge technology for the mobility and industrial space, including light vehicles, commercial vehicles, and industrial applications.
